Alleged iPhone 17 Air Renders Reveal Pixel-Like Camera Bar and Ultra-Slim Design

Apple is reportedly set to introduce a bold new design with the iPhone 17 series, and fresh leaks suggest that the iPhone 17 Air will replace the Plus model in the lineup. According to leaked renders, the device adopts a Pixel-like horizontal camera bar and an ultra-slim profile, potentially making it the thinnest iPhone ever.

iPhone 17 Air Alleged Design Details

Tech insider Jon Prosser, via Front Page Tech, has shared new renders based on alleged final design details of the iPhone 17 Air.

📷 Redesigned Camera Bar – The elongated pill-shaped camera module resembles the Google Pixel 9 series.
🔹 48MP Single Rear Camera – Positioned on the left side of the bar.
🔹 Microphone & LED Flash – Placed on the right side for an optimized layout.
📏 Ultra-Slim Profile – At 5.5mm thickness, it could surpass the iPhone 6’s 6.9mm to become the thinnest iPhone ever.
🖥 Dynamic Island Stays – Apple retains the Dynamic Island for an immersive front display experience.
🚀 A19 Chipset – Expected to power the device, ensuring top-tier performance and efficiency.
📸 Camera Control Button – A new addition that could enhance photography and video capabilities.
🔗 e-SIM & In-House 5G Chipset – Expected to be integrated, eliminating the need for a physical SIM slot.

Differences Between iPhone 17 Air & Pro Models

According to tipster Digital Chat Station, Apple’s iPhone 17 lineup will feature distinct designs across variants.

🔹 iPhone 17 Air – Features a Pixel-like camera bar and a single rear camera sensor.
🔹 iPhone 17 Pro – Expected to sport a larger matrix-style camera island, similar to POCO smartphones.

Apple has already made subtle design changes in the iPhone 16 series, shifting to a vertical pill-shaped camera module for non-Pro models.

Production & Launch Timeline

According to leaks, the iPhone 17 Air has entered the NPU phase at Foxconn’s factory, indicating it is moving towards mass production.

📅 Expected Launch: September 2025 at Apple’s Annual Fall Event.
